King-size beds, breakfasts by a log fire, a garden room bar with library,
maps and a warm welcome await our guests. Breakfast is served in the drawing
room where a log fire burns on dewy early mornings, and the view from the
window stretches from Hartland Point to Lundy Island over the little white
town of Bideford. Food is freshly prepared using home produced and locally
sourced ingredients: fruit from the garden, home made yoghurt and
prize-winning local meats. Please tell us if you follow a special diet.
We can help you organise cycling on the Tarka Trail, cliff walking, surfing,
canoeing, and other water sports. There is a different beach for each day of
your holiday within easy reach; Dartmoor and Exmoor to explore, gardens at
RHS Rosemoor and Tapeley as well as the fishing villages of Clovelly and
Appledore.
